#1350af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1350af is composed of 7.5% red, 31.4%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 216.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 38%. #1350af color hex could be obtained by blending #26a0ff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#1350af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1350af has RGB values of R:19, G:80,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1265839.

Shades and Tints of #1350af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020710 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1350af
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6064 is the less saturated color, while #044dbe is the most saturated one.
